Best Easy Reads With Happy Endings?

4 Answers2025-08-19 19:32:45
I absolutely adore books that leave me with a warm, fuzzy feeling, and 'The House in the Cerulean Sea' by TJ Klune is one of those rare gems. It’s a heartwarming story about a caseworker who visits a magical orphanage and finds love, family, and acceptance. The whimsical setting and lovable characters make it impossible to put down. Another favorite is 'Eleanor Oliphant Is Completely Fine' by Gail Honeyman. It’s a touching story about loneliness, friendship, and healing, with a protagonist who’s both quirky and endearing. For something lighter, 'The Flatshare' by Beth O’Leary is a delightful rom-com about two people sharing an apartment and falling in love through post-it notes. Each of these books has a happy ending that feels earned and satisfying, perfect for when you need a pick-me-up.

Where To Find Light Hearted Reads With Happy Endings?

4 Answers2025-08-20 00:39:38
I adore light-hearted reads with happy endings because they always leave me feeling uplifted and satisfied. One of my all-time favorites is 'The House in the Cerulean Sea' by TJ Klune. It's a whimsical, heartwarming story about love, acceptance, and finding your place in the world. The characters are endearing, and the writing is filled with humor and warmth. Another great pick is 'Eleanor Oliphant Is Completely Fine' by Gail Honeyman, which balances humor and emotional depth beautifully. For those who enjoy romance, 'The Hating Game' by Sally Thorne is a delightful enemies-to-lovers story with witty banter and a satisfying ending. If you're into fantasy, 'Howl's Moving Castle' by Diana Wynne Jones offers a charming, magical adventure with a cozy feel. And don't miss 'The Guernsey Literary and Potato Peel Pie Society' by Mary Ann Shaffer and Annie Barrows—it’s a heartwarming epistolary novel about friendship and love post-WWII. These books are perfect for anyone needing a cozy escape.
